• Dublin ends its ‘robo cop' pilot program (nbc4i.com) — Dublin has ended its yearlong pilot of the DubBot security robot, deciding the autonomous patrol device didn’t meet the city’s needs after technical issues and no tickets or arrests. The robot had monitored the Rock Cress parking garage, and a second unit once planned for Riverside Crossing Park and the Dublin Link bridge was never deployed. City officials say they remain committed to exploring technology that genuinely improves safety and services.

• Case of dismembered legs found in Columbus trash facility in 2017 still unsolved (dispatch.com) — Dublin is one of several communities whose trash routes are linked to a still-unsolved 2017 case where human legs were found at a Columbus waste facility. Investigators later identified the victim as Columbus resident Candice Taylor, but nearly a decade on, police still have no suspects. Crime Stoppers is again asking for tips and offering a cash reward.

• USGA alters golf ball rollback plan, earns surprise PGA Tour endorsement (golf.com) — Dublin briefly took center stage in golf’s distance debate when USGA CEO Mike Whan met with a 16-player advisory group at the Memorial Tournament here, helping spur a new joint plan on golf ball rollback. The USGA, R&A, PGA Tour and DP World Tour now back a single January 2030 implementation date and are exploring broader equipment changes. The final impact on the pro game remains unsettled.
